vimarsana.com
Home
Smile Data Package
Top Locations Tagged with Smile Data Package
Smile Data Package in United States - 16803/Computer-products near Centre
1). Simile Data And Telecom, Innovation Blvd Ste
vimarsana © 2020. All Rights Reserved.